A Neighbor in Need
Ms. McCaw, a resilient 52-year-old neighbor, has navigated the hardships of Crohn’s disease for most of her life. Relying on Social Security benefits, she finds steadfast support in her devoted daughter, who lives with her husband and their young child under the same roof.
Rallying Around the McCaw Family
On June 26 & 27 Catalyst and a compassionate team of volunteers from Living Hope Fellowship joined forces to help the McCaw family. Their mission: replace the family’s aging fence, which no longer provided the safety and peace of mind they deserved.
Hearts and Hands at Work
With unwavering dedication, twenty volunteers—many accompanied by their children—offered over 200 hours of service to transform the McCaws’ property. Parents worked side by side with their kids, showing the next generation the joy and value of serving others, all while creating cherished memories together.
